Output 361aa21479922935f85b31926308f02272df6ec69e933211d9f84af5e12afb42:0

value
450971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ecba0286eff8c640dca3244dbe69e549511343aa OP_EQUAL
address
3PGiE1RmcHAh9ysYHA1XXto7btHvKsqPSL
transaction
361aa21479922935f85b31926308f02272df6ec69e933211d9f84af5e12afb42
confirmations
217570
spent
true